Role and Playstyle

  • Role: Hydro Support/Shielder, ATK Speed Buffer
  • Key Mechanics:
    • Elemental Burst (Radiant Psalter): Hits enemies with AoE Hydro DMG and gives your team a shield that scales with Dahlia’s HP (250% stronger against Hydro DMG). It also boosts ATK Speed based on his Max HP (0.5% per 1,000 HP, max 20%). You can keep the shield going by earning Benison stacks through Freeze reactions or Normal Attacks.
    • Elemental Skill (Mist-Rain Mystery/Sacramental Shower): Creates a field that either explodes for Hydro DMG when enemies touch it or launches your character upward for exploration or Plunging Attacks.
    • Passive (Utility): Speeds up your party’s movement by 10% during the day (06:00–18:00) in the overworld, but it doesn’t work in Domains or Spiral Abyss.
    • C6 (Notable Constellation): Lets you revive one teammate to full HP when they’re under Favonian Favor, but only once every 15 minutes.

Dahlia’s great for Freeze teams since his shield refreshes with Frozen enemies, and he helps Normal Attack-focused characters swing faster. He’s not the best for off-field Hydro application, so he doesn’t always click with folks like Furina.


Best Weapons

Dahlia needs weapons that pump up his HP% and Energy Recharge to make his shields beefy and keep his Burst ready. Here’s what works:

  1. Key of Khaj-Nisut (5-star)
    • Why: Gives a ton of HP% (up to 66.2% at R1), making shields and ATK Speed boosts stronger. Also throws in some Elemental Mastery for the team, which is nice in reaction teams.
    • Source: Limited Weapon Banner.
  2. Sacrificial Sword (4-star)
    • Why: Boosts Energy Recharge (up to 61.3% at R1) and might reset your Elemental Skill cooldown, helping you spam Burst more.
    • Source: Gacha.
  3. Favonius Sword (4-star)
    • Why: Same Energy Recharge as Sacrificial (up to 61.3% at R1) and makes energy particles for your team, keeping Burst uptime solid.
    • Source: Gacha.
  4. Fleuve Cendre Ferryman (4-star, F2P)
    • Why: Decent Energy Recharge (up to 45.9% at R1) and a bit of Elemental Skill CRIT Rate, which is okay for free-to-play players.
    • Source: Fountain Fishing Association.
  5. Sapwood Blade (4-star, F2P)
    • Why: Lowers Energy Recharge (up to 30.6% at R1) but gives a small EM boost for reaction teams. Good enough if you’re on a budget.
    • Source: Sumeru Craftable.

Note: Skip team support weapons like Freedom-Sworn; they don’t really help Dahlia’s kit.


Best Artifacts

You want artifacts that max out HP% for beefy shields and ATK Speed buffs, plus Energy Recharge to keep his Burst up. Check these out:

  1. 4-piece Tenacity of the Millelith
    • Why: Ups HP by 20%, which helps shields and ATK Speed, and gives your team a 20% ATK boost plus 30% Shield Strength when you hit enemies with your Skill. The buff only lasts 3 seconds, so it can be tricky to keep it going.
    • Main Stats: HP% Sands, HP% Goblet, HP% Circlet
    • Sub Stats: Energy Recharge, HP%, Elemental Mastery, DEF%
  2. 4-piece Noblesse Oblige
    • Why: Makes your Burst hit 20% harder and gives the team a 20% ATK buff for 12 seconds, which is easier to maintain than Tenacity. Great for team support.
    • Main Stats: HP% Sands, HP% Goblet, HP% Circlet
    • Sub Stats: Energy Recharge, HP%, Elemental Mastery
  3. 2-piece HP% + 2-piece HP% (e.g., Vourukasha’s Glow, Tenacity of the Millelith)
    • Why: Stacks HP (up to 40% combined) for tougher shields and better ATK Speed buffs. Good while you’re grinding for a full set.
    • Main Stats: HP% Sands, HP% Goblet, HP% Circlet
    • Sub Stats: Energy Recharge, HP%, Elemental Mastery

Stat Priority:

  • HP%: Shoot for ~40,000 HP to hit that 20% ATK Speed cap.
  • Energy Recharge: 150–200%, depending on your weapon and team (less if you’ve got Sacrificial or Favonius).
  • Elemental Mastery: Handy for reaction teams like Freeze or Vaporize.
  • DEF%: Helps shields a bit but isn’t a must.

Talent Priority

Dahlia’s all about his Elemental Burst, with his Elemental Skill as a backup for energy and some Hydro application. Normal Attacks? Barely touch ‘em.

  • Priority: Elemental Burst (Radiant Psalter) > Elemental Skill (Mist-Rain Mystery/Sacramental Shower) > Normal Attack (Favonia’s Fencing Style)
  • Leveling: Get Burst and Skill to Level 8–10; leave Normal Attack at Level 1 unless you’re doing some Plunge attack shenanigans.

Talent Materials (per talent to Level 10):

  • Books: Teachings of Ballad (x9), Guide to Ballad (x63), Philosophies of Ballad (x114)
    • Source: Forsaken Rift (Mondstadt, Wednesday/Saturday/Sunday)
  • Common Drops: Damaged Mask (x18), Stained Mask (x66), Ominous Mask (x93)
    • Source: Hilichurl Shooters (Teyvat-wide)
  • Boss Material: Eroded Scale-Feather (x18)
    • Source: Lord of Eroded Primal Fire (Fontaine, Stone Stele Records)
  • Crown of Insight: x1 (from Events or stuff like Frostbearing Tree)
  • Mora: ~1.6M per talent

Ascension Materials

To max Dahlia out at Level 90:

  • Gems: Varunada Lazurite Sliver (x1), Fragment (x9), Chunk (x9), Gemstone (x6)
    • Source: Hydro bosses (Hydro Tulpa, Hydro Hypostasis, Rhodeia of Loch, Solitary Suanni)
  • Local Specialty: Calla Lily (x168)
    • Source: Lakes and rivers in Mondstadt (like Starfell Lake) or Sumeru (Avidya Forest, Gandharva Ville)
  • Boss Drop: Secret Source Code (x46)
    • Source: Secret Source Automaton: Overseer Device (Natlan, Atoclan)
  • Common Drops: Damaged Mask (x18), Stained Mask (x30), Ominous Mask (x36)
    • Source: Hilichurl Shooters
  • Mora: ~420,000

Total Cost (0✦ to 6✦): Check sites like Icy Veins or Lootbar for exact breakdowns.

Pre-Farming Tip: Stock up on Calla Lilies and Hilichurl Masks early—they’re everywhere in Mondstadt. The Natlan boss for Secret Source Code can be tough, so bring a good team.


Best Team Compositions

Dahlia’s a star in Freeze teams since his shield loves Frozen enemies, and he’s solid with Normal Attack DPS characters who dig his speed boost. Here’s who he hangs with:

  1. Freeze Team (Top Pick)
    • Dahlia (Hydro Support): Brings shields and ATK Speed buffs.
    • Skirk (Hydro DPS): Loves the ATK Speed boost and Freeze setup.
    • Rosaria/Diona (Cryo Sub-DPS/Support): Rosaria adds CRIT Rate, Diona piles on more shields.
    • Sucrose/Kazuha (Anemo Support): Groups enemies and pumps up Elemental DMG with Viridescent Venerer.
    • Rotation: Sucrose/Kazuha E > Diona/Rosaria Q > Dahlia Q > Skirk Q/Normal Attacks.
  2. Vaporize Team
    • Dahlia (Hydro Support): Shields and speeds up attacks.
    • Marjorie (Pyro DPS): Sets off Vaporize with Dahlia’s Hydro.
    • Xingqiu (Hydro Sub-DPS): Keeps Hydro flowing for Vaporize.
    • Bennett (Pyro Support): Heals and boosts ATK.
    • Rotation: Bennett Q > Xingqiu Q > Dahlia Q > Marjorie NA/CA.
  3. Plunge Attack Team (Niche)
    • Dahlia (Hydro Support): Sets up Plunging Attacks with his Skill.
    • Xiao/Diluc (Anemo/Pyro DPS): Smashes with Plunge DMG.
    • Xianyun (Anemo Support): Buffs Plunge DMG and heals.
    • Furina (Hydro Sub-DPS): Ups team DMG with Fanfare stacks.
    • Rotation: Xianyun E/Q > Dahlia E > Furina Q > Xiao/Diluc Plunge.

Note: Dahlia’s not great at off-field Hydro, so he’s not Furina’s best buddy. Stick to Freeze teams or pair with someone like Xingqiu for Hydro application.


Constellations

Dahlia’s constellations make him an even better support:

  • C1 (Infallible Procession): Gives back 2.5 Energy per Benison stack during Burst, helping you use it more often.
  • C2 (Revelation of Mercy): Boosts Shield Strength by 25% for 12s after using Benison stacks.
  • C3: Ups Burst level by 3 (max 15).
  • C6: Revives one teammate to full HP under Favonian Favor, but only once every 15 minutes. Super handy for tough fights.

Recommendation: C1 and C2 help with energy and shields; C6 is awesome for the revive but not a must-have.


Playstyle Tips

  • Rotation: Kick off with your support skills (like Anemo or Cryo), use Dahlia’s Skill to build energy, then pop his Burst for Favonian Favor. Swap to your DPS and Freeze enemies or spam Normal Attacks to keep the shield up.
  • Exploration: His Skill lets you jump high for Plunging Attacks or to reach tricky spots, and the daytime Movement Speed boost makes running around easier.
  • Energy Management: Aim for 150–200% Energy Recharge for consistent Bursts, especially without Sacrificial Sword.
  • Team Synergy: He’s great with Cryo characters (Skirk, Wriothesley) for Freeze or Normal Attack DPS (Ayato, Yoimiya) for ATK Speed. Don’t rely on him for Hydro in Vaporize teams.

Pros and Cons

Pros:

  • First 4-star Hydro shielder, fills a cool niche.
  • ATK Speed buff helps Normal Attack DPS shine.
  • Rocks Freeze teams with his shield-refresh trick.
  • Easy to build with F2P weapons and materials.
  • Handy for exploration with speed and jumps.

Cons:

  • Weak off-field Hydro application, so he’s not great with Furina.
  • Shield uptime needs Freeze or Normal Attacks, limiting team options.
  • Tenacity’s buff is short (3–6s) and hard to keep up.
  • Doesn’t deal much damage since he builds HP but scales with ATK.
